The foundation of DOMiNO is a deep-seated Croatian patriotism that prioritizes national independence over supranational aspirations. Its ideology is shaped by a conservative worldview, which regards the traditional nuclear family as the bedrock of society. The party sees itself as the guardian of Croatian identity and history, strongly opposing liberal social currents and a perceived decline in values. In this context, the state is primarily understood as a sanctuary for its people and their cultural heritage.
DOMiNO's agenda is firmly rooted in a "Croatia First" policy. Key demands include a restrictive immigration policy, robust support for domestic producers, and the preservation of traditional societal norms. The party primarily targets value-conservative citizens, patriotic voters, and residents of rural areas who feel unrepresented by centrist mainstream parties. DOMiNO places a strong emphasis on demographic issues, advocating for extensive state incentives for families with multiple children.
Strategically, DOMiNO positions itself as an uncompromising right-wing opposition force or a corrective partner within conservative coalitions. The party views itself as an authentic original, aiming to solidify Croatia's rightward political shift. Regarding the rule of law, it emphasizes national sovereignty over EU institutions. Its strategic calculus is to bridge the gap between the moderate conservative camp and radical fringe groups, thereby acting as a gravitational center for all national-conservative forces in the country.
